Transaction 3051fddf64f36708f62ded4c10d200406c9e5f78e541e406cab583d1d852723e
1 Input
1 Output
-
3051fddf64f36708f62ded4c10d200406c9e5f78e541e406cab583d1d852723e:0
- value
- 7380815
- script pubkey
- OP_0 OP_PUSHBYTES_20 4e57cbc07c25a7abf177912f08d3586f554a1978
- address
- bc1qfetuhsruykn6huthjyhs356cda255xtcpuwnut